Health Benefits of Idli and Dosa:

  • Nutritional value- Idlis and dosas are rich in carbohydrates, proteins and essential vitamins. The fermentation process increases the bioavailability of nutrients, making them easier to digest and more nutritious.
  • Low fat- Both idli and dosa are low in fat, making them a healthy breakfast. Idlis, in particular, are steamed, which further reduces their calorie content.
  • Good for digestion — The fermentation process creates probiotics, which are beneficial for gut health. These probiotics help maintain a healthy digestive system and improve overall gut function.

Tips for Perfect Idlis and Dosas:
Idly tips-

  • Make sure the batter has a thick, pourable consistency. If it is too thin, the idli will not rise properly.
  • Do not open the steamer lid too often as it will cause the idlis to collapse.
  • Allow the idlis to cool slightly before removing them from the moulds so that they don’t stick.

Dosa Tips-

  • Before pouring the batter, make sure the pan is hot enough. A drop of water should sizzle and evaporate quickly.
  • Spread the batter quickly and evenly for thin, crispy dosas.
  • For a healthier option use minimal oil, but enough to prevent sticking.

Popular Sidedishes for Idli and Dosa:

  • Coconut Chutney — A classic accompaniment made with fresh coconut, green chillies and coriander.
  • Tomato Chutney — A delicious chutney made with tomatoes, onions and spices.
  • Mint Chutney — A refreshing chutney made with mint leaves, curd and green chillies.
  • Sambar — A lentil-based vegetable stew with a mixture of tamarind and spices. Sambar is a nutritious and tasty side dish that pairs perfectly with idlis and dosas.
  • Podi — A dry spice mix made from roasted lentils and chillies. Mix this powder with oil or ghee and serve it with idlis and dosas for added flavour.
